Benchmarks are used to track the quality of the PR splitter over time.
To run the benchmarks use pnpm benchmarks. The results will be stored in benchmark_history/
input/: the diff of the pull request to split. Created using git diff <BASE> <HEAD>
gold/: the desired split for each hunk in the order that they should appear. An array of array of hashes of each hunk.

The correctness of the grouping is quantified using pairwise F1-score which focuses on how well pr-splitter correctly placed two pairs of hunks that should be within the same group within the same group.
- Idea: Consider each pair of changed hunks in the diff of a pull request.
- For instance, if the diff contains 4 hunks
h1,h2,h3,h4, examine all possible pairs like (h1,h2), (h1,h3), ..., (h3,h4)
- For instance, if the diff contains 4 hunks
- True label: whether the two hunks should be grouped together according to a human
- Prediction: whether the two hunks were grouped together by
pr-splitter - Results:
- True Positive (
TP): the human says the two hunks should be grouped together and thepr-splitteragrees - False Positive (
FP): the human says the two hunks should not be grouped together but thepr-splittergrouped them together - False Negative (
FN): the human says the two hunks should be grouped together but thepr-splitterdid not group them together
- True Positive (
Then compute precision, recall, and F1-score from TP, FP, and FN.
